Binance Faces Hurdles Re-entering UK Crypto Market After Regulatory Changes
-
Binance, the world's largest crypto exchange, is struggling to re-enter the UK market after suspending services there in October.
-
The UK's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) changed rules last year requiring crypto firms to register or partner with an approved third party.
-
Binance attempted to partner with Rebuildingsociety.com, but the FCA blocked the partnership.
-
At least 3 other firms declined offers to approve Binance's marketing after the FCA expressed concerns.
-
A Binance spokesperson said it's inaccurate to say Binance was rejected by UK approvers and is confident of a "positive update soon."
